1
0
Fork 0
This repository has been archived on 2023-03-27. You can view files and clone it, but cannot push or open issues or pull requests.
lpr-partynest/config/database.yml

53 lines
1.9 KiB
YAML
Raw Normal View History

2018-11-22 14:33:08 -05:00
default: &default
adapter: postgresql
encoding: unicode
2018-11-22 15:20:06 -05:00
2018-11-22 14:33:08 -05:00
# For details on connection pooling, see Rails configuration guide
# http://guides.rubyonrails.org/configuring.html#database-pooling
2018-11-22 15:20:06 -05:00
pool: <%= ENV.fetch('RAILS_MAX_THREADS') { 5 } %>
2018-11-22 14:33:08 -05:00
2018-11-22 15:20:06 -05:00
# Connect on a TCP socket. Omitted by default since the client uses a
# domain socket that doesn't need configuration. Windows does not have
# domain sockets, so uncomment these lines.
host: <%= ENV.fetch('POSTGRES_HOST') { 'localhost' } %>
# The TCP port the server listens on. Defaults to 5432.
# If your server runs on a different port number, change accordingly.
port: <%= ENV.fetch('POSTGRES_PORT') { 5432 } %>
2018-11-22 14:33:08 -05:00
# The specified database role being used to connect to postgres.
# To create additional roles in postgres see `$ createuser --help`.
# When left blank, postgres will use the default role. This is
# the same name as the operating system user that initialized the database.
2018-11-22 15:20:06 -05:00
username: <%= ENV.fetch('POSTGRES_USER') { 'partynest' } %>
2018-11-22 14:33:08 -05:00
# The password associated with the postgres role (username).
2018-11-22 15:20:06 -05:00
password: <%= ENV.fetch('POSTGRES_PASSWORD') { 'password' } %>
2018-11-22 14:33:08 -05:00
# Schema search path. The server defaults to $user,public
#schema_search_path: myapp,sharedapp,public
# Minimum log levels, in increasing order:
# debug5, debug4, debug3, debug2, debug1,
# log, notice, warning, error, fatal, and panic
# Defaults to warning.
#min_messages: notice
2018-11-22 15:20:06 -05:00
development:
<<: *default
database: <%= ENV.fetch('POSTGRES_DB') { 'partynest_development' } %>
2018-11-30 02:26:46 -05:00
production:
<<: *default
database: <%= ENV.fetch('POSTGRES_DB') { 'partynest_production' } %>
2018-11-22 14:33:08 -05:00
# Warning: The database defined as "test" will be erased and
# re-generated from your development database when you run "rake".
# Do not set this db to the same as development or production.
2018-11-30 02:26:46 -05:00
test: &test
2018-11-22 15:20:06 -05:00
<<: *default
database: <%= ENV.fetch('POSTGRES_DB') { 'partynest_test' } %>
2018-11-22 14:33:08 -05:00
2018-11-30 02:26:46 -05:00
cucumber:
<<: *test